What is AAMI Park's capacity?
AAMI Park has a capacity of 30,050.
How do I get to AAMI Park?
Nearest public transport: Richmond Station (10 min walk) or trams 70/75. Public transport is the easy option — limited on-site parking, but the stadium sits inside Melbourne's free tram zone.
When was AAMI Park opened?
The stadium opened in 2010. It has previously been known as Melbourne Rectangular Stadium.
Which teams play at AAMI Park?
Melbourne Storm play home matches here.
